I just purchased a (mint) Winchester Parker Reproduction A-1 Special, 12 gauge two barrel set 26" IC & MOD, 28" Mod & full, with leather bound oak case and cover. I have the Parker identification and serialization book and the two Parker History books. I can't seem to locate by serial number when this gun was manufactured. It does however have "Made in Japan" engraving. Serial number for this gun is 112-044. Does anyone have any info on these guns? Much appreciated, Ed |
Hi neighbor!
That low number 044 should make it among the earliest. Possibly around 1989 - 90 I would guess. Somebody here probably has a more accurate date. Good to see you on here again Ed. . |
